AP State Committee of CPI(ML)–New Democracy has expressed its deep sorrow at the sudden death of veteran communist revolutionary and state leader of CPI(ML)–Unity Initiative, Com. Mandla Subba Reddy and paid its revolutionary tributes to his memory. Com. Subba Reddy died on April 24th night due to a heart attack in the middle of the treatment when it seemed that he was recovering. Com. Subba Reddy was born in a middle class family in Veligodu in Kurnool district in AP. From his school days he was inspired by communism and participated in several movements against the British imperialists. In 1942 he became a member of the Communist Party of India. Com. Subba Reddy always stood with the revolutionary politics in the two splits in the Indian Communist Movement – that in the CPI in 1964 and a few years later in CPM in the wake of Naxalbari armed struggle. He always remained sincere towards Marxism-Leninism-Mao Thought. He spent 22 years in underground life and participated in several struggles along with Com. CP and Com. Ramnarsaiah. He took a leading role in the struggle of poor peasants and agricultural labourers and for tribal rights. Com. Subba Reddy was deeply pained at the splits among the revolutionaries, and wished to unite all the revolutionaries. But he left us before his dream could come true. |
